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/kotlin/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Sas Proc的意思是前缀?_Sas - Fatal编程技术网

Sas Proc的意思是前缀?

Sas Proc的意思是前缀?,sas,Sas,小问题,但如果我们有以下问题: proc means data = have; class &ind_vars.; var &dep_vars.; output out = want sum = ; 理想情况下,我想将所有因变量之和的输出重命名为n_u[dependent var goes here],也就是说,我只想添加一个前缀,指示这些变量表示和。但是,使用sum=[name]只是将所有变量更改为具有该名称,而不是添加前缀 在过程中有什么方法可以做到这一点吗?我知道我可以在

小问题,但如果我们有以下问题:

proc means data = have;
class &ind_vars.;
var &dep_vars.;
output out = want sum = ;
理想情况下,我想将所有因变量之和的输出重命名为n_u[dependent var goes here],也就是说,我只想添加一个前缀,指示这些变量表示和。但是,使用sum=[name]只是将所有变量更改为具有该名称,而不是添加前缀


在过程中有什么方法可以做到这一点吗?我知道我可以在一个单独的步骤中很容易地完成这项工作…(甚至可以在视图中预先将所有依赖变量重命名为sum_dependent_var),但我认为可能有一个内置选项,我相信很多人都想做。如果在输出语句中添加
/autoname
,它将自动生成所有名称[stat]\uvar]。这听起来像是你想要的

proc means data=sashelp.class;
var age height weight;
output out=blah n= sum= /autoname;
run;